    • Receptacle connector with a stuffer bar within retention sections of the contacts

    • A transceiver assembly includes a receptacle guide frame configured to be mounted to a host circuit board, where the receptacle guide frame has a front being open to an interior space, and where the receptacle guide frame is configured to receive a pluggable module through the front. A receptacle connector is received within the interior space of the receptacle guide frame at a rear of the receptacle guide frame. The receptacle connector includes contacts having contact tails configured to be mounted to a circuit board. The contacts have retention sections positioned at a predetermined location relative to the contact tails, and the contacts have mating sections configured for mating with a mating connector. A housing holds the contacts and has a front and a rear with a cavity at the front being configured to receive the mating connector. The housing has a shelf at the rear. A stuffer bar is separately provided from the housing and securely coupled to the rear of the housing. The stuffer bar is received within the retention sections of the contacts and engages the contacts to hold the contacts against the shelf such that the contact tails are aligned with one another.

    • Transceiver module assembly with unlatch detection switch

    • An electrical module assembly is provided that is configured for latching engagement with a receptacle assembly. The module assembly comprises a module housing having an exterior envelope and an interior cavity. The exterior envelope of the module housing is configured to be plugged into the receptacle assembly. A release mechanism is joined to the module housing. The release mechanism is moveable between locked and unlocked positions. The release mechanism is configured to unlock the module housing from the receptacle assembly when the release mechanism is moved from the locked position to the unlocked position. A detection switch is located within the interior cavity of the module housing. The detection switch monitors a position of the release mechanism and provides latched and unlatched state signals based on the position of the release mechanism. The latched state signal indicates that the module housing is locked in the receptacle assembly. The unlatched state signal indicates that the release mechanism is being moved to the unlocked position.

    • Retention system for removable heat sink

    • A heat sink (60) having one or more cooling fins (64) along a central shaft (66) is securable to an active device substrate (12) by a spring clip (80) whose latch sections (92) are latched under latch projections (44) on side walls (40) of the housing (30) to which the substrate (12) is mounted. The bow-shaped formed wire spring clip (80) has arcuate inner sections (82) disposed against the central shaft (66) of the heat sink (60) and exerts spring force downwardly on a retention fin (68) of the heat sink (60) when latched to the housing (30), which holds the bottom surface (62) of the heat sink (60) against the top substrate surface (22) to create a thermal connection.

    • Electrical contact assembly

    • A three piece electrical contact assembly that includes an inner sleeve that is stamped and formed into a tubular shape from a flat sheet of metal. The electrical contact assembly provides a secure electrical and mechanical connection when crimped to a wire without the need for welding or brazing a seam (31) that results from forming the contact. The contact assembly includes: an inner sleeve having an enlarged middle portion (35) having forwardly and rearwardly facing shoulders for retention of the contact in a connector insert and a plurality of axially arranged slots (32) arranged in the wire receiving end of the contact assembly allow the contact assembly to distort symmetrically when a wire is crimped inside the contact; and a first and second outer sleeve (10,20) telescopically located over the front and rear portions, respectively, of the inner sleeve.
